Mid Level Environmental Scientist Jobs: Frequently Asked Questions

How do I get a mid level environmental scientist job?

Position yourself by highlighting project ownership rather than task completion. Employers hiring at this level want to see that you've managed deliverables, coordinated with regulators or clients, and made technical decisions independently. Tailor your resume to show specific projects you led, reports you authored, and any specialized methods or permits you've worked with. Certifications like HAZWOPER or a state environmental certification strengthen your application.

Are there remote mid level environmental scientist jobs?

Yes, though the role is field-intensive enough that fully remote work is less common than in purely office-based fields. About 30% of mid level environmental scientist openings are remote or hybrid as of August 2026, typically covering report writing, data analysis, and regulatory documentation. Roles involving site investigation, sampling, or field inspection generally require in-person presence at least part of the time.

How do I move up to a mid level environmental scientist role?

The path from entry level to mid level is built by taking on progressively larger responsibilities over your first few years. That means moving from assisting on projects to coordinating them, developing fluency in a specialty area like remediation, air quality, or wetlands, and building a record of delivering reports and regulatory submissions independently. Earning a professional certification or state licensure and demonstrating measurable impact on project outcomes accelerates the transition.
